Morgan Jones Recruitment Consultants is seeking a Head of Financial Planning for a hybrid role in Medway.

You will lead a team of about 25 finance and financial systems professionals, drive annual revenue budgeting and medium-term planning, and provide strategic financial advice across the organisation.

This senior role requires a qualified accountant with local government experience, strong leadership, and change management skills.
